*{margin:0;padding:0;box-sizing:border-box}body{font-family:"Source Sans 3",sans-serif;background:linear-gradient(135deg,#fef7ed,#f0f9ff,#fdf2f8);min-height:100vh;color:#374151;line-height:1.7}.theme-badge{display:inline-block;background:linear-gradient(135deg,#ecfdf5,#d1fae5);color:#065f46;padding:12px 28px;border-radius:20px;font-weight:500;font-size:.95rem;border:1px solid #a7f3d0;box-shadow:0 4px 12px #10b9811a}.navigation{display:flex;flex-direction:row-reverse;flex-wrap:wrap;gap:1rem;justify-content:space-between;align-items:center;padding-top:30px;border-top:1px solid rgba(229,231,235,.6)}.btn{padding:16px 36px;border:2px solid transparent;border-radius:25px;font-weight:500;cursor:pointer;transition:all .3s ease;font-size:1rem;text-transform:uppercase;letter-spacing:.8px}.btn-primary{background:linear-gradient(135deg,#8b5cf6,#a855f7);color:#fff;box-shadow:0 8px 20px #8b5cf633}.btn-primary:hover{transform:translateY(-3px);box-shadow:0 12px 28px #8b5cf64d}.btn-secondary{background:#fffc;color:#6b7280;border-color:#e5e7ebcc;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.btn-secondary:hover{background:#fffffff2;color:#374151;transform:translateY(-2px);box-shadow:0 8px 16px #0000000d}.explanation{background:linear-gradient(135deg,#fcf0ffcc,#f3e8ff99);border-left:4px solid #a855f7;padding:28px;margin-top:35px;border-radius:0 16px 16px 0;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border:1px solid rgba(168,85,247,.2)}.explanation-title{font-weight:600;margin-bottom:12px;color:#581c87;text-transform:uppercase;font-size:.9rem;letter-spacing:.8px}.container.svelte-14xkkph{max-width:900px;margin:0 auto;padding:40px 30px}.footer.svelte-14xkkph{text-align:center;padding:40px;color:#6b7280;font-size:.95rem;border-top:1px solid rgba(229,231,235,.4);margin-top:50px;background:#ffffff4d;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:20px}@media (max-width: 768px){.container.svelte-14xkkph{padding:20px 15px}}
